denarius serratus, Aurelius Scaurus, M. (fl. 118 BC), publisher, Licinius Crassus, L. (fl. 118 BC), publisher, Domitius Ahenobarbus, Cn. (fl. 118-96 BC), publisher, Roma (mythology), warrior on a biga, shields, helmets, carnyx, spears — bigas, Attic helmets, warriors, head of Roma. Obv. Head of Roma in an Attic helmet to right; in front inscription M.AVRELI (VR in ligature); behind inscription ROMA and value sign X (crossed out). Beaded border. Rev. Naked warrior on a biga to right, holding reins and shield and carnyx in left hand, a spear in right; below inscription SCAVRI (AVR in ligature); below line the inscription L.LIC.CN.DOM. Pearl border. 118 BC, Roman Republic (505–27 BC). Narbonne; coin; diameter 20.3 mm; weight 3.78 g; axis 0°.
